Widespread Panic will offer up a full show download of the band’s October 20, 2017 stop at Milwaukee’s Riverside Theatre as the Driving Songs release for the year.

In a note posted to the band’s website, John Bell said the band decided against a compilation of tracks from the band’s touring year to showcase the “balance and flow of song selection” more prevalent in a cohesive show.

“We also liked the idea of having John Keane mix a whole show with our present Gang of Prayers…uh, Players,” Bell said.
